On September 20th, 2019, the Graduation Ceremony was held in honour of the 5th batch of students attending the School of Tropical Medicine and Global Health.

On September 20th, 2019, the graduation ceremony was held for our MTM, MPH, and MSc students. In total thirty students graduated: seven MTM students; thirteen MPH students; and ten MSc students. Well done to you all!

In the morning the graduation ceremony was held at the Central Auditorium of the Nagasaki University Bunkyo Campus. In the afternoon a Thank You party was given at the TMGH building of the Sakamoto Campus. Students old and new, faculty, and support staff all participated in the party to celebrate the graduating students on the completion of their studies and to say goodbye, as well.

Some students will resume working in their countries, and others will go on to the doctoral programme or start a new career.
